Iraqis View Security Agreement as having a Flexible Timetable

Iraqis View Security Agreement as having a Flexible Timetable

Juan Cole

Al-Zaman reports in Arabic that the Iraqi cabinet approved the security agreement between the Bush administration and the Iraqi government. It will now go to the Iraqi parliament, where it will be voted on on November 24. Out of 36 cabinet members, 28 were present for Sunday’s vote (a lot of Iraqi politicians actually live […]
